RELAXED: Kathryn Wright from Victoria in her 1911 Fiat that her husband spent more than 2000 hours restoring.
RELAXED: Kathryn Wright from Victoria in her 1911 Fiat that her husband spent more than 2000 hours restoring.

MORE than 70 vehicles arrived in town from Tarana when the Oberon Tarana Heritage Railway hosted the seventh International Tour of the Horseless Carriage Society on Monday.
